[SERVER-32229] Powercycle - handle remote host restarts Created: 08/Dec/17  Updated: 29/Jan/18  Resolved: 08/Dec/17

Status: Closed
Project: Core Server
Component/s: Testing Infrastructure
Affects Version/s: None
Fix Version/s: None

Type: Task Priority: Major - P3
Reporter: Jonathan Abrahams Assignee: DO NOT USE - Backlog - Test Infrastructure Group (TIG)
Resolution: Duplicate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Duplicate
duplicates SERVER-32228 Powercycle - handle remote host restarts Closed
Backwards Compatibility: Fully Compatible
Participants:

 Description   

For power cycle events, it would be proper if the host is unreachable to do the folowing:

  • Check the status of the instance
  • If the instance is stopped, attempt to start it
  • If the start fails then mark this as a system failure

This could be done in evergreen.yml in the post and timeout phases. For the powertest.py script, it can also retry to start if it detects a stopped instance, however it would be more difficult to mark this as system failure, unless a dedicated exit code is used,


Generated at Thu Feb 08 04:29:37 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.